    Usually start up to a blank screen without the Apple Logo, may report one of the following:

    • Hardware failure
    • Boot drive is not recognized as valid and updated updated
    • OS X essential software is missing, hurt moved or renamed or corrupt
    • A firmware update is necessary

    No matter who, in order to boot from an external drive "bootable", you would normally hold down the Option key until you get a screen that offers a number of devices to try to boot from.

    Alternatively, you can try holding down the C key to try to boot from the external drive.

    If none of these startup options work, then the bootable disc or the USB port on your MacBook Pro can be the question.

    Since you have a Mac pre-2013, if you hold down the D key while booting, the built-in Apple Hardware Test should start up.  This can help to identify hardware problems.

  • Resets the bootcamp?

    Hello, I just I want to improve my Mac in El Captain.

    But I think, and maybe my Bootcamp perhaps will reset if I update to El Captain (10.11).

    Because this is a family computer, I don't want to reinstall Mac and Bootcamp at the same time.

    If in my iMac 20 inch mid-2007 version (Lion) 10.7.5 reset Bootcamp if I update to 10.11?

    My bootcamp in detail: Windows XP: Home Edition SP3.

    And my mac: iMac: 20-inch mid-2007.

    It will not be unless a problem arises. Back up your data first.

    Note that it is not directly possible to implement this configuration of Boot Camp again; Lion and will be more recent work with the existing installations of XP and Vista Boot Camp, but cannot be used to create new ones. In doing so, should be temporarily returning to Snow Leopard.

  • Why bootcamp tries to download something, even if I gave it ISO windows

    Hello.

    I recently bought a new macbook pro MJLT2 I tried to install windows via bootcamp 10 I gave him the necessary ISO, but it tries to download something, and he said about 400hrs time remained to download this thing! and my connection speed is about 5 Mb/s. What happens and why is it?

    BTW, it works on OS X El Captain 10.11.2

    It's the Windows Support software download which is needed to provide a Windows PE (Preboot Environment) and drivers for Apple hardware after installing Windows.
